Mr. Bouchillon, who resided at 1004 South Washington St, died about 7 a.m. Saturday in a local hospital .
The Rev. Travis Gibson pastor of the Melwood Baptist Church, will officiate at the services.
Mr. Bouchillon was born in Lee County Feb. 23, 1913. He was a truck driver.
Survivors include four sisters, Mrs. Elma White of Lexington, Mrs. Annie Leyendecker of Corsicanna and Mrs. Docia Bowers and Mrs. Joscia Modawell of Brownwood, and Four brothers, Harvey Bouchillon of Lexington, R.M. Bouchillon of Midland, R. L. Bouchillon of Brady and E. D. Bouchillon of Coleman.
